Crafting an Enduring Tribute: Obituary Writing Guide
When a cherished soul departs this world, their legacy deserves to be remembered in a way that is both meaningful and lasting. Crafting an obituary is more than just relaying facts; it's about capturing the essence of their spirit. It's a a poignant tribute on their life, share stories, and connect with those who loved them.
A heartfelt commemoration can provide solace and comfort to grieving friends, while also sharing important details for generations to come.
This guide offers helpful guidance on how to craft an obituary that is both informative and evocative, ensuring your tribute is a a cherished record of the life that was lived.
Begin with essential details. Consider their full name, birth date, death date, place of birth and residence, professional journey, and any military service or memberships in societies.
Highlight stories that reveal their personality, interests, passions, and accomplishments. Remember to share anecdotes that bring a smile.
